Le Touquet-Paris-Plage: the 7 essential activities

Welcome traveler friends, today, let's go to France, on the banks of the English Channel, to discover the “Station of the 4 seasons”: Le Touquet-Paris-Plage. Located 200 km north of the capital, Le Touquet owes its popularity largely to the incredible range of sporting and leisure activities. A resort for Parisians and Lille residents, Le Touquet attracts up to 250,000 visitors in season. The reputation of Le Touquet is well established: a mythical and chic city, a natural and lively city in all seasons, a city with timeless architecture, all bordered by a wild and preserved 11 km beach. The magic of the coast: Canche Bay Natural Park

Put on your sneakers and head to Le Touquet beach, a natural jewel of 11 km of fine sand and dune spaces. The Baie de Canche Natural Park is located on the northern tip of Le Touquet. Access is easy for pedestrians and cyclists. From the nautical center which offers a breathtaking view of the estuary, walk a few meters to reach the motorhome area. Further on, let’s take the “Boucle de la Corniche”. The latter runs along the northern tip to the ornithological observatory which overlooks the bay.

From there, you can observe migratory birds, but also seals sleeping on the sandbanks at low tide. Then head south, following the dune to the end of the seafront, then returning to the nautical center. This 3 km loop will excite your senses: breathe the iodized air with the scent of maritime pines, observe the extraordinary light of this bay, listen and let yourself be lulled by the sound of the wind, the waves and the seagulls circling in a opal sky. This route is only one possibility among others, 2 other shorter trails are offered to you: “The pinède loop” and “The dune loop”.

Golf Resort du Touquet: ranked in the Top 100 of the most beautiful golf courses in the world

Le Touquet Golf Resort

We left some friends behind on the Corniche trail, others headed to the nautical center for an introduction to sand yachting. We decide to move away a little from the shore and enter the forest area of Le Touquet. For us, it will be heading towards the Golf Resort. Thanks to its privileged natural environment between dunes and forest, Le Touquet Golf Resort welcomes amateurs and experienced golfers on 3 courses, classified among the 100 most beautiful courses in Europe and the world.

In all weather, you can access 2 18-hole courses and 1 9-hole course. The Manoir's 9-hole course is a shorter event, but adapted to the vagaries of the weather or to a more limited playing time. The “La Forêt” route takes place in the heart of the pine forest. As for the 18-hole course “La Mer”, with an international reputation, it is a “links”, it is a course located by the sea or in an exceptional dune area. Golf is played all year round on the Touquet green.

The sandy soil capable of draining effectively ensures remarkable playing comfort on the three courses offered. Le Touquet Golf Resort also offers an introduction to the game, a discovery of the equipment as well as a practice; without forgetting the “putting” competitions and other team challenges.

Le Touquet equestrian park, one of the most beautiful French sites

Le Touquet equestrian center

We are leaving a few friends at the Golf Resort du Touquet again, for us it will be heading to the Hippodrome du Touquet in the heart of the forest. Horse riding is one of the other key sports in Le Touquet. At the equestrian park, one of the most beautiful French sites dedicated to horses, beginners and jockeys come together. Baby pony, riding lessons, equine therapy, acrobatics, etc. are some of the many activities offered to the general public.

The advanced training courses, courses or walks help to approach the animal gently while offering a unique point of view on the resort. The “Dunes and Beach” course and that of “La Forêt” allow the rider to appreciate all the natural beauty of the landscapes.

The Canche Bay nautical center: sails ahead

Canche Bay Le Touquet Nautical Center

We are on Le Touquet beach, on the horizon we can see the sailboats drifting further and further away. Closer to us, the colorful sails of windsurfing boards dot the sea with bright, multicolored spots.

A catamaran approaches the shore at high speed. Then, we look up to the sky, a multitude of small parachutes spinning towards the north halo the azure sky, hundreds of kite surfers have arranged to meet. The sea then serves us as a flamboyant and living postcard. We let our friends gallop away on their horses.

We decide to try windsurfing. We learn that at the Canche Bay nautical center, we have the possibility of obtaining our coastal license, but we can also and quite simply rent equipment (kayak, canoe, paddle, giant paddle, pedal boat, catamarans, dinghy , windsurfing and even an electric e-foil…). We are in an ideal spot for everyone and even for the youngest with the offer of optimist courses.

Tennis Le Touquet club: first clay court tennis center in France

Intoxicated by the iodine-laden air, we will finish our sporting journey at the Le Touquet tennis club. The first Pierre de Coubertin clay court tennis center in France.

18 clay courts, 3 outdoor all-weather clay courts and 5 indoor courts. We experience padel tennis (at the crossroads of tennis and squash). Let's head to the 25 m long outdoor swimming pool, heated to 28 degrees. We are served a delicious cocktail at the very lively and chic bar.

Discover animated life? Le Touquet has 300 shops, 70 restaurants, a multitude of bars, 5 nightclubs

Rue Saint-Jean in Le Touquet

Well rested and in great shape again, we join our friends to discover the city center. A plethora of restaurants, bars, shops, with elegant and sometimes surprising decorations welcome us. We will stop, of course, at the “Chat Bleu”, the unmissable chocolate factory in Le Touquet and we will continue to the bottom of rue Saint-Jean for the best crepe in the world (personal opinion) at the “Mignardises” where you won't have to be surprised to see a fairly large queue, be patient, it is well worth the effort.

We wander through the streets and are surprised by the number of quality shops that this resort offers. The time has come for an aperitif and some of us will have it at the “Impasse” for our more “party-loving” friends, at the “Westminster” bar for those seeking tranquility and an ultra-chic atmosphere.

We will have our fill at the “Café des Sports” for fans of excellent, friendly brasseries and impeccable culinary quality. For the most demanding, head to “Le Pavillon”, the “Café des Arts”, “Les deux Moeaux” or even the “Village Suisse”… Thus ends our “Touquet travel tour”, for us it will be the hotel but be aware that Le Touquet is also life at night…..
